Comprehending Manufacturing Processes for Contemporary Steel Window Frames
New steel window frames undergo advanced manufacturing, combining precision engineering with robust fabrication. The making of these durable steel framed windows commences with high-grade steel profiles, which are precisely cut, often by laser, to form the complex components of each steel sash windows unit. Welding then connects these sections, creating a monolithic structure crucial for the inherent strength of industrial windows.
The subsequent finishing processes are critical for the duration and aesthetic charm of steel windows. This includes grinding and polishing welds to attain seamless lines, followed by various surface treatments such as galvanization or powder coating for enhanced corrosion resistance, particularly vital for exterior fenestration. This meticulous process guarantees that each steel window, whether for a copyrightd door or a larger architectural installation, meets stringent quality standards, embodying both durability and refined architectural beauty in modern construction.
How steel casement and awning windows are distinguished
steel Windows, specifically casement and awning configurations, present distinct operational and aesthetic characteristics. steel frame windows with a casement design pivot outwards from side copyrights, supplying expansive views and excellent ventilation. Conversely, steel awning windows are copyrightd at the top, opening outward to create a canopy that enables for ventilation even during light rain, a notable advantage for these steel windows.
The inherent power of metal and stainless steel enables for slender window frames in both styles of steel windows, maximizing glazing area. While both offer secure closure, the outward-projecting nature of both casement and awning steel frame windows facilitates superior weather sealing. These identifying features make steel windows versatile choices for various architectural applications.
Considerations for Thermal Performance and Glazing Options in Steel Windows
Modern Steel Windows attain superb thermal performance through sophisticated glazing and thermally broken frames, vital for energy efficiency in Nederland. High-performance glass, including double and triple glazing with low-emissivity coatings and inert gas fills, significantly reduces heat transfer in Steel Windows. This allows various styles like steel casement windows, steel awning windows, steel double hung windows, steel sliding windows, and even steel picture windows to fulfill stringent energy codes. The integration of a thermally broken barrier within the steel frames prevents conduction, enhancing the insulation of all Steel Windows.

Comparing steel with aluminum and bronze window substances
While steel windows are famed for their strength and narrow sightlines, aluminum windows provide a lightweight, corrosion-resistant alternative, often at a lower cost. Bronze windows, conversely, provide a unique aesthetic with their warm, rich patina, embodying timeless elegance. However, bronze is significantly more expensive and softer than steel. The inherent rigidity of steel windows allows for larger expanses of glass and greater structural integrity compared to both aluminum and bronze. Aluminum's higher thermal conductivity often necessitates thermal breaks, a quality frequently integrated into modern steel windows designs to enhance energy performance. For ultimate durability and security, steel windows consistently exceed their aluminum and bronze counterparts, especially in demanding architectural applications.
